Zhangmu Town Climate

The climate in Zhangmu is warm and temperate. There is significant rainfall throughout the year in Zhangmu. Even the driest month still has a lot of rainfall. The average temperature in Zhangmu is 18.1 C. The average annual rainfall is 1,569 mm. The driest month is December. There is 48 mm of precipitation in December. Most precipitation falls in April, with an average of 200 mm.

‣ Zhangmu Temperature

The precipitation varies 152 mm between the driest month and the wettest month. The average temperatures vary during the year by 24.1 C. Rain season is mainly from March to August. And the temperature is ranging from 8℃ to 29℃. Though it is rainy all year round, the temperature is moderate, which makes it suitable for travel in summer and winter.
